CodeRabbit (coderabbit.ai), yazılım geliştirme ekipleri için GitHub ve GitLab platformlarına entegre olan, yapay zekâ tabanlı bir kod inceleme asistanıdır.
Geleneksel statik analiz araçlarının aksine, kodun sadece yazım hatalarını değil, iş mantığını (logic) ve bağlamını anlayarak bir "Senior Developer" gibi yorum yapar. Her Pull Request (PR) için satır satır inceleme yaparak hataları bulur, iyileştirme önerir ve geliştiricilerin kod inceleme süresini %70'e kadar azaltır.
2026 itibarıyla 100.000'den fazla organizasyon tarafından kullanılan CodeRabbit, kodun okunabilirliğini artırmak ve hataları ana koda birleşmeden yakalamak isteyen ekipler için standart bir araç haline geldi. En büyük farkı, AI ile kod satırları üzerinden doğrudan sohbet edebilmenize olanak tanımasıdır.
Temel Özellikler
Yapay zekâ destekli kod incelemesi: Her PR gönderildiğinde saniyeler içinde devreye girer, mantıksal hataları ve performans sorunlarını kod satırına yorum olarak bırakır. Bağlamsal anlama: Sadece değişen satırları değil, tüm projeyi analiz ederek değişikliğin genel mimarideki etkilerini değerlendirir.
Otomatik PR özetleri: Yapılan tüm teknik değişiklikleri insan dilinde özetler ve test edilmesi gereken yerler için bir kontrol listesi oluşturur. Kod üzerinde AI ile sohbet: AI'nın bıraktığı yorumlara cevap verebilir, "Bunu daha iyi nasıl yazarım?" diye sorarak anlık öneriler alabilirsiniz. Birim test üretimi: Eksik test senaryolarını fark eder ve önerilen kod değişiklikleri için otomatik unit test blokları hazırlar. Geniş dil desteği: Java, Python, JS, TS, Go, C++, Rust ve daha birçok dilde best-practice önerileri sunar. Güvenlik taraması: Kod içine sızmış API anahtarlarını, SQL injection risklerini ve diğer güvenlik açıklarını gerçek zamanlı yakalar. Kurumsal standartlara uyum: Şirketinizin özel kod yazım kurallarını AI'ya öğreterek denetim yapmasını sağlayabilirsiniz.
Kimler İçin Uygun?
Hızlı kod inceleme ve hata tespiti isteyen yazılım ekipleri Kod kalitesini standardize etmek isteyen CTO ve yöneticiler Açık kaynak (Open Source) proje yöneticileri İkinci bir göz arayan solo yazılımcılar Junior yazılımcıları eğitmek ve mentorluk vermek isteyen ekipler Güvenli kod yazımına önem veren SaaS ve Fintech şirketleri
Fiyatlandırma (2026 güncel)
Ücretsiz Plan: Açık kaynaklı (Open Source) projeler için sınırsız ve tamamen ücretsizdir. Pro Plan: Kullanıcı başına aylık ≈ 15-20 USD. Özel depolar (private repo), sınırsız inceleme ve gelişmiş AI özellikleri içerir. Enterprise Plan: Şirkete özel fiyatlandırma. Self-hosting (kendi sunucuna kurma), özel kural setleri ve SSO desteği gibi kurumsal özellikler sunar. Ücretsiz Deneme: Pro özelliklerini test etmek için 14 günlük kredi kartı gerektirmeyen deneme süresi mevcuttur.
Kullanım Bilgileri
GitHub, GitLab ve Bitbucket ile doğrudan entegre çalışır Bulut tabanlıdır; kurulum gerektirmez, sadece ilgili repo için yetki vermeniz yeterlidir Kodunuz modelleri eğitmek için kullanılmaz (SOC 2 uyumlu ve gizlilik odaklı) Arayüz ve yorumlar genellikle İngilizcedir ancak Türkçe kod yapılarını da anlayabilir Mobil uyumludur; PR bildirimlerini ve AI yorumlarını telefondan takip edebilirsiniz API desteği sayesinde özel iş akışlarına dahil edilebilir
Örnek Kullanımlar
Performans iyileştirme → Bir "for" döngüsü içinde gereksiz veri tabanı çağrısı yaptığınızda CodeRabbit bunu fark eder ve daha verimli bir "query" önerir. Mantıksal hata tespiti → "Burada bir null pointer exception riski var, şu kontrolü eklemelisin" diyerek sizi uyarır. Hızlı PR yönetimi → 1000 satırlık bir değişikliği incelemek yerine CodeRabbit'in özetini okuyup kritik uyarılarına odaklanarak zaman kazanırsınız. Öğrenme ve mentorluk → Yeni bir dile geçen geliştiriciye, o dilin en iyi yazım standartlarını (naming conventions vb.) otomatik olarak hatırlatır. Güvenlik kontrolü → "Şifre bilgisini düz metin olarak loglamışsın" uyarısıyla kritik bir veri sızıntısını önler.
CodeRabbit, bir yapay zekâdan ziyade ekibinize katılan çok hızlı ve bilgili bir kıdemli yazılımcı gibidir. Kod kalitesini artırırken ekiplerin üzerindeki manuel inceleme yükünü alır.
